Output 77ca6a969f33b58d05138e07718384f72559820d4a3ccc675e16e9769cf0e008:1

value
6983843306107
script pubkey
OP_0 OP_PUSHBYTES_20 a8fe84aad776eec98d9acfe9013e3f763d52cc18
address
tb1q4rlgf2khwmhvnrv6el5sz03lwc749nqc0ffgwe
transaction
77ca6a969f33b58d05138e07718384f72559820d4a3ccc675e16e9769cf0e008
confirmations
158074
spent
true